Understanding Probability and Risk Assessment

At the heart of any successful strategy within a lab casino environment lies a deep understanding of probability. It is not merely acknowledging that a coin has a 50/50 chance of landing on heads or tails, but a nuanced comprehension of how independent events combine to influence overall outcomes. This includes understanding concepts like expected value, variance, and standard deviation. Expected value, for instance, calculates the average profit or loss anticipated from a specific bet or game, taking into account both the potential payout and the probability of winning. Variance measures the degree to which outcomes deviate from the expected value, providing insight into the level of risk involved. A higher variance indicates greater potential for both significant gains and substantial losses. Effective risk assessment isn't about avoiding risk altogether, but rather about quantifying it and making informed decisions based on your risk tolerance and the potential reward.

The Role of Simulation and Modeling

Before committing real capital, astute players often employ simulation and modeling techniques. This involves creating virtual environments that replicate the dynamics of the chosen game, allowing for the testing of various strategies without financial consequence. These simulations can run thousands, or even millions, of iterations, providing a statistically significant dataset to analyze. Mathematical models, ranging from simple spreadsheets to complex algorithms, can be used to predict outcomes, identify optimal betting patterns, and assess the impact of different variables. For example, a model might be created to analyze the optimal betting progression in a roulette game, taking into account factors like the table limits, the house edge, and the player’s starting bankroll. The more accurate the model, the more reliable the insights it provides and the more confidence a player can have in their chosen strategy.

Bankroll Management and Optimal Betting Strategies

Even with a sophisticated understanding of probability and data analysis, success in a lab casino demands disciplined bankroll management. This involves setting aside a specific amount of capital dedicated solely to gaming and adhering to strict rules regarding bet sizing and risk exposure. A common rule of thumb is to never risk more than 1-2% of your bankroll on a single bet. This helps to mitigate the impact of losing streaks and preserve capital for future opportunities. Optimal betting strategies, such as the Kelly Criterion, aim to maximize long-term growth while minimizing the risk of ruin. The Kelly Criterion calculates the optimal percentage of your bankroll to bet on a given opportunity, based on your perceived edge and the odds offered. However, the Kelly Criterion can be aggressive, and many players choose to use a fraction of the Kelly bet to reduce risk.

The Psychology of Betting

Beyond the mathematical aspects of bankroll management, understanding the psychology of betting is critical. Emotional betting, driven by factors like frustration, greed, or overconfidence, can quickly erode a bankroll. It’s important to approach gaming with a detached, analytical mindset, treating it as a long-term investment rather than a source of quick riches. Setting pre-defined stop-loss limits and profit targets can help to prevent emotional decision-making. For example, a player might decide to stop playing after losing 10% of their bankroll or after reaching a specific profit target. Maintaining a disciplined approach and avoiding impulsive bets are essential for long-term success in any form of gaming.

  1. Establish a dedicated bankroll separate from essential funds.
  2. Define a unit size (e.g., 1% of the bankroll).
  3. Set stop-loss and profit targets.
  4. Avoid chasing losses.
  5. Review performance regularly and adjust strategies.

Disciplined bankroll management isn't merely about preventing losses; it’s about establishing a sustainable and responsible approach to gaming.

Advanced Techniques: Game Theory and Exploitative Play

For those seeking to push the boundaries of their strategic approach, game theory offers a powerful framework for analyzing interactions in competitive gaming environments, particularly in poker. Game theory optimal (GTO) strategies aim to identify unexploitable play, meaning that no opponent can consistently gain an advantage by deviating from the GTO strategy. However, GTO strategies can be complex and difficult to implement in practice. Exploitative play, on the other hand, focuses on identifying and exploiting the specific weaknesses of individual opponents. This requires careful observation of opponents' tendencies and adjusting your strategy accordingly. The key is to balance GTO fundamentals with exploitative adjustments, adapting your play to the specific context of each game. Mastering this balance requires a deep understanding of both game theory and human psychology.
